Coldcard Security Breach Linked to At Least 15 Attackers
New reports suggest multiple attackers exploited a vulnerability in Coldcard wallets that could have been prevented with minor security upgrades.
coinbeat.newsSecurity researchers recently identified that at least 15 different attackers took advantage of a specific vulnerability in Coldcard hardware wallets. The discovery highlights the persistent risks users face when storing their digital assets on cold storage devices if those devices contain software flaws.
A managing partner at Dragonfly suggested that the breach was preventable. According to their assessment, simple security hardening techniques costing as little as two dollars might have protected users from these specific attacks. This highlights how small improvements in design can have a massive impact on user safety.
